Did Jesus have a wife? New study points towards ‘yes’

Researchers at Columbia University have started running new tests on the highly controversial papyrus text, called the “Gospel of Jesus’ Wife,” which may validate its authenticity, according to The Independent.

Mormon leaders pledge to back gay rights under one condition

Mormon leaders sought Tuesday to put their conservative church on middle ground in a major culture war issue — saying for the first time that they support some legal anti-discrimination protections for LGBT people, so long as the religious freedom of those who oppose gay equality is taken into account.

Philly families asked to take in guests when pope visits

Residents of the Philadelphia area are being asked to show some brotherly love to those traveling to the city to see Pope Francis next year. With hotel rooms filling up fast, organizers hope to find more than 10,000 households willing to host guests in their spare bedrooms for a modest fee.

Pastor who officiated gay son’s wedding can keep ordination

A U.S. pastor who was defrocked after officiating his son’s same-sex wedding ceremony, and later reinstated, can keep his ordination, a Methodist judicial council has ruled.
